The point of this table is the lift. Most overbed tables need a knob wound or a lever held, which rules them out for a client with weak grip or only one hand free. The CareTek Easy Lift uses a compression lock: raise the top and it rises, let go and it holds where it was left. Someone in bed can set it themselves, one handed.
It rolls on lockable twin wheel castors and the base slides under most beds and recliners, so the table comes to the client rather than the other way round. The frame is powder coated steel in off white with a laminated top that wipes down, which keeps it looking like furniture rather than ward equipment.
It suits clients who spend long periods in bed or a recliner and need meals, a laptop or medication within reach: people recovering at home after discharge, palliative clients, and residents in aged care. The one handed lift is what makes it work for people with limited grip or reach.
Good to know
- Table top 425 mm by 900 mm, laminated MDF
- The 700 mm wheel base slides under most beds and recliners, check clearance under low beds
- Delivered assembled, 1 year warranty
